It either blocks (discards packets) or allows them to go through using a list of predefined rules. The firewall monitors both inbound and outbound traffic. But it also protects internal networks from unknown and unwanted external traffic. For instance, a firewall stops Malware or any application from opening ports and establishing communication to the outside. What many people neglect about firewalls (refer to the diagram below) is that they do not only protect an internal network from external threats coming from public networks (inbound traffic), but they also protect the outbound traffic from leaving an internal network.
